2005 Suisun Valley Fume Blanc

The Ledgewood Creek Winery & Vineyards PicNique is a delightful white wine that exemplifies the charm of the Suisun Valley region. This 2005 Fume Blanc boasts a medium body, providing a wonderfully balanced mouthfeel that is neither too light nor overly heavy. Its acidity is bright and lively, creating a refreshing experience on the palate that perfectly complements its pronounced fruit intensity. The wine reveals vibrant notes of citrus and stone fruits, inviting you to savor each sip. With a dry profile, it offers a crisp finish that leaves a lasting impression, making it an excellent choice for picnics or simply enjoying as an aperitif. This Fume Blanc is a true representation of the quality and character found in Suisun Valley wines.

Region:


California
California

California is one of the most diverse winegrowing regions in the world. Spanning 850 miles along North America's west coast—and inland across mountains and valleys—California's American Viticultural Areas (AVAs) cover a dizzying array of terroir. The cold, deep waters of the Pacific Ocean play a major role in cooling California's vineyards, sending fog and chilly air up to 100 miles inland. This tempers the daytime heat and allows grapes to ripen slowly but fully. Cooler-climate grape varieties thrive closest to the sea, while further inland, bigger, bolder wines prevail.
